Table 3. Post-thaw sperm physiology and viability parameters for the giant grouper (E. lanceolatus) with different DMSO concentrations in ELS3 and ELRS3.

Sperm diluents Concentration
of DMSO (%)
Ratio of fast
motion (%)
Ration of slow
motion (%)
Time of fast
motion (sec)
Time of slow
motion (sec)
Lifespan (sec) Motility (%)
ELS3 0 0.66 ± 0.48c 4.20 ± 1.55c 49.73 ± 8.47d 155.53 ± 50.03c 356.60 ± 89.57de 4.86 ± 1.66c
5 6.87 ± 3.20bc 23.03 ± 4.70bc 56.93 ± 23.48d 165.83 ± 43.92c 673.00 ± 266.38cd 29.90 ± 3.45c
10 15.74 ± 6.41b 35.64 ± 5.08ab 200.37 ± 31.38c 430.43 ± 132.84b 868.67 ± 218.65c 51.38 ± 3.25b
15 28.85 ± 8.99a 39.51 ± 17.79ab 331.67 ± 24.34b 558.97 ± 37.34b 1373.67 ± 238.34b 68.37 ± 25.23ab
20 15.90 ± 9.45b 39.45 ± 16.63ab 306.10 ± 46.13b 421.20 ± 84.03b 1258.90 ± 119.39b 55.35 ± 16.98b
30 5.75 ± 3.33c 8.87 ± 1.50c 202.23 ± 27.79c 360.13 ± 52.80b 162.67 ± 32.13e 14.62 ± 4.17c

ELRS3 0 3.16 ± 2.29b 7.35 ± 1.45d 47.23 ± 15.34c 106.70 ± 7.07d 293.50 ± 86.10c 10.51 ± 3.69c
5 7.04 ± 3.49b 14.86 ± 1.35cd 91.37 ± 36.83c 186.23 ± 55.52d 320.57 ± 103.95c 28.56 ± 8.12bc
10 20.56 ± 10.81a 21.52 ± 10.11c 132.00 ± 43.21c 268.70 ± 51.52d 774.47 ± 166.41bc 35.42 ± 11.92b
15 33.43 ± 11.65a 41.33 ± 2.68b 327.47 ± 27.81b 814.87 ± 31.14b 1795.13 ± 38.26a 74.75 ± 12.71a
20 5.47 ± 2.04b 20.55 ± 1.69c 156.23 ± 43.35c 426.40 ± 76.69c 1221.30 ± 532.15b 26.02 ± 3.22bc
30 4.90 ± 3.55b 17.73 ± 6.39c 90.90 ± 10.09c 203.23 ± 31.58d 499.40 ± 38.34cd 22.63 ± 9.43bc

Fresh sperm 30.33 ± 1.07a 50.37 ± 0.31a 450.23 ± 105.85a 1114.57 ± 156.67a 1919.90 ± 367.52a 80.70 ± 1.37a

The highest sperm parameters were obtained using 15% DMSO in ELRS3, and relatively high average values were obtained for sperm parameters using 15% DMSO in ELS3 (n = 3, P < 0.05). Values are means ± standard deviation, and means with different letters (a, b, c, d, e) are significantly different (P < 0.05).
